8194460 Richa Riding Jackets | Premium Collection & Free Delivery

Premium Richa Riding Jackets Collection Richa logo

Discover Excellence in Richa Riding Jackets

Experience the finest selection of Richa Riding Jackets. Our premium collection combines innovative design with superior craftsmanship. Free UK delivery on all orders.

Read More
Richa